Review of Elektra Luxx (2011) by Zaid S — 28 Mar 2011
What a fantastic little movie:).
I make no bones about being a huge fan of Carla and Joseph Gordon-Levitt has really made a niche for himself these last few years so those two combined with other familiar faces seemed a good bet. The result is a very humorous movie, not laugh out loud too often but you'll be smiling along with the ups and downs of Elektra's life, the antics of Bert and his female circle, the neighbours and various others two of which are played by Adrianne Palicki and Timothy Olyphant.
The cast is really excellent and surely at least one name will peak a potential viewers interest and don't be put off by the premise, there is some strong language but no nudity just suggestive and similar to what you'll find even on some network tv shows these days.
Give it a go I don't think you'll be disappointed:).
